The FreeClip are Huawei's first open-ear earbuds, combining wireless audio and a chic design in a versatile device, that could easily be mistaken for jewellery. Now users can enjoy the comfort of open-ear listening and express their personal style at the same time. Thanks to the innovative C-bridge Design, they fit snugly along the curvature of the ear. The C-bridge Design is the centrepiece of the FreeClip and acts as the earbuds’ clip and the connector between the acoustic and battery units. The FreeClip’s design is based on data from research done on the ears of over 10,000 people resulting in a refined micron-level ergonomic design that has undergone over 25,000 reliability tests. The result is that the earbuds stay in place even during the most intense physical activities.

The FreeClip's open-ear listening technology delivers clear and immersive sound without blocking ambient noise. To minimise sound leakage and ensure privacy, the earbuds use a reverse sound wave system that intelligently adjusts the volume and cancels the sound waves that “leak” out of the earbuds.

The earbuds come in a shell-shaped charging case that has a pearlescent sheen and a smooth stone-like texture, offering a comfortable grip and a unique aesthetic that blends simplicity and elegance. With the charging case, the FreeClip boasts a total music playback time of 36 hours. If the battery runs low, users can quickly charge the earbuds for 10 minutes and enjoy three hours of listening.

Announced during IFA 2022, HONOR’s Spatial Audio solution is designed to enable headphones to produce wide, cinematic 3D sound effects that create the sense of immersion required for next-generation AR and VR experiences.

At its core, HONOR's Spatial Audio is designed to deliver surround sound and 3D audio through headphones by using the accelerometer and gyroscopes in earbuds to track the motion of the user’s head, remapping the sound field to bring users an immersive and delightful audio experience in all scenarios such as movies, music and games. And by means of the algorithm, the changes of sound on its way from the source to the listener's ear can be simulated. These effects include localization of sound sources above, below, behind and in the front of the listener.

HONOR's Spatial Audio is the first to support sound externalization distance adjustment, providing users to dynamically adjust the distance of virtual sound sources from 0.15 to 10 meters to suit a more personalized listening experience.

The HUAWEI MatePad T 10s features a Full HD IPS panel supporting a resolution of 1920x1200 and 70 percent of the NTSC colour gamut (typical value). At 10.1 inches, the 16:10 display has a high pixel density of 224ppi to ensure detail in any image or video is presented with impeccable sharpness. The display also supports HUAWEI ClariVu Display Enhancement technology, which dynamically optimises colour, brightness and saturation, as well as a Huawei-developed Super Resolution algorithm that scales up lower-res content for a more immersive experience. 


From an audio perspective, Harman Kardon amplitude speakers are located symmetrically on the sides of the HUAWEI MatePad T 10s. The speakers have been redesigned to allow for a longer stroke path than traditional audio systems in tablets, ensuring the tablet can achieve a higher audio volume with low distortion. HUAWEI Histen 6.1 enables the support of 9.1-channel 3D surround sound with options for users to configure the audio experience according to their preference, as well as Bass Booster, which offers smart optimisation that enhances the bass.

Since the hinge is a critical feature for any foldable phone. The design and placement of the hinge can have a significant impact on the phone’s overall look and display design. HONOR developed the Floating Waterdrop Hinge technology, integrating a perfect hinge and foldable design to offer a symmetrical, thin, and seamless form factor, the hinge design allows the phone to be closed seamlessly.

A more interesting part of the design is the expansive display.  The HONOR Magic V features a 6.45-inch 44° curved OLED display when folded, achieving a wider 21.3:9 aspect ratio and this makes the device exceptionally user-friendly and functional, as the screen functions like a traditional smartphone, rather than appearing long and narrow. The HONOR Magic V unfolds to an extra-wide 7.9-inch creaseless display, delivering a more immersive tablet-like experience which is ideal for viewing content, multi-tasking and increasing productivity while working.


Another major step for this foldable is that HONOR Magic V body incorporates premium aerospace-grade materials to ensure greater precision, more strength and durability while also providing a lighter weight for the hinge mechanism, including zirconium-based liquid metal, which is three times tougher than stainless steel. The premium aerospace-grade materials help the device to be lighter and create more balance resulting in a phone with an excellent center of gravity.
